Donkey power: accepted yet neglected

The paper attempts to give credit to a donkey as a potential alternative source of draft power in the event of loss of cattle. The animal has always complemented the work done by cattle even under normal climatic conditions. The 1991/92 cropping season was hard hit by a drought spell that ripped-off thousands of cattle in the small farming areas of Zimbabwe. The small farmers have very little access to tractor technology if one could think of it as an alternative means. Within the farmers reach there is a draft animal that can play a big role and that is a donkey. The donkey has not suffered much although some deaths have been reported. The paper discusses the potential of a donkey to agriculture
